How to cancel Freeletics on the website

If you subscribed directly through the Freeletics website, this is the clearest cancellation route and leaves you with the best documentation.

Step-by-step website cancellation

  1. Open your web browser and go to freeletics.com.
    • Log in with your email address and password.
    • If you have forgotten your password, use the "Forgot password?" link to reset it.
  2. Click on your profile icon or account menu (usually top right corner).
    • Look for "Settings", "Account", or "Profile" option.
  3. Find and open the "Subscription" or "Plan" section.
    • This page displays your active plan, next renewal date, and billing history.
  4. Look for a button labeled "Cancel subscription", "Pause subscription", or "Manage subscription".
    • If you see a "Pause" option, know that pausing temporarily freezes your subscription without cancelling it-you will still be charged when the pause ends unless you cancel outright.
  5. Click to cancel and confirm your cancellation.
    • Freeletics may ask why you are cancelling or offer you a discount to stay. Answer honestly or decline the offer depending on your choice.
    • Read the confirmation screen carefully to ensure your cancellation is final.
  6. Take a screenshot of the confirmation page showing your cancellation is complete.
    • Save this screenshot and your confirmation email for your records.

How to cancel Freeletics if you subscribed through the app store or google play

If you subscribed through Apple's App Store or Google Play Store instead of the website, you must cancel through that platform, not through Freeletics directly. This is a common source of confusion and accidental double charges.

Cancelling on apple app store (iPhone or iPad)

  1. Open the App Store app on your iPhone or iPad.
    • Do not open the Freeletics app itself.
  2. Tap your profile icon in the top right corner.
    • Select "Subscriptions" from the menu.
  3. Find Freeletics in your active subscriptions list.
    • Tap on it to open the subscription details.
  4. Tap "Cancel subscription" or "Edit subscription".
    • You may see options to pause or modify before cancel-choose "Cancel" to remove the subscription entirely.
  5. Confirm your cancellation when prompted.
    • Apple will send you a cancellation confirmation email to your Apple ID address.
  6. Save the confirmation email and take a screenshot of the cancelled status in the App Store.
    • Your access to Freeletics ends on the current billing cycle end date, not immediately.

Warning: Do not simply delete the Freeletics app from your phone. Deleting the app does not cancel the subscription-you will still be charged when your next renewal date arrives.

Cancelling on google play store (Android)

  1. Open the Google Play Store app on your Android device.
    • Tap your profile icon in the top right corner.
  2. Select "Manage subscriptions" from the menu.
    • This shows all active subscriptions linked to your Google account.
  3. Find and tap on Freeletics in the active subscriptions list.
    • Tap "Cancel subscription".
  4. Choose a cancellation reason from the dropdown (optional but helpful for feedback).
    • Confirm your cancellation.
  5. Check your email for a cancellation confirmation from Google Play.
    • Screenshot this confirmation for your records.
  6. Verify in the Google Play Store that Freeletics now shows as "Cancelled" rather than "Active".
    • Your access ends on the current billing cycle end date, not immediately.

Refunds and your consumer rights in malaysia

Understanding your legal position strengthens your case if something goes wrong during cancellation or a charge appears after you have cancelled.

Can you get a refund after cancellation?

This depends on timing. If you cancel before your renewal date, you are not entitled to a refund for the remainder of your current billing period-you have already paid for that access, and you keep it until the period ends. However, if a charge appears after you have cancelled, or if you cancel within a specific grace period, you may have grounds for a refund.

Malaysia's Consumer Protection Act 1999 gives you the right to cancel a distance contract (which includes online subscriptions) within 10 calendar days of purchase if you change your mind-but only for the initial purchase, not for automatic renewals. If you are well past that 10-day window, your cancellation does not trigger an automatic refund; it simply stops future charges.

What the consumer protection act 1999 says about subscriptions

Under the Consumer Protection Act 1999, a distance contract is one made without face-to-face contact (like an online subscription). You have the right to cancel within 10 days of purchase without a penalty, provided you notify the supplier in writing. However, digital services like Freeletics are exempt from this cooling-off period once you have downloaded or accessed the service.

This means if you signed up and immediately started using Freeletics, you cannot claim the 10-day refund right. What you can do is cancel the subscription to stop future charges. If the company continues charging you after cancellation, that is when the Consumer Protection Act becomes your lever for a refund and compensation.

Common mistakes people make when cancelling Freeletics

Cancellation feels straightforward in hindsight, but in the moment, most people rush and skip a critical step-then regret it when the next charge appears.

Mistake 1: deleting the app instead of cancelling the subscription

Removing Freeletics from your phone does absolutely nothing to your subscription. The charge keeps coming month after month because the subscription is tied to your Apple ID or Google account, not your phone storage. Always cancel through your subscription settings, never through app deletion.

Mistake 2: cancelling on the website when you subscribed via app store or google play

Your subscription is anchored to whichever payment channel you used to sign up. If you bought through App Store, the App Store controls your subscription and your billing-cancelling on the Freeletics website will not stop the App Store from charging you. Always cancel where you subscribed.

Mistake 3: pausing instead of cancelling

Freeletics may offer a "Pause subscription" option, which sounds like cancellation but is not. A paused subscription will resume and charge you automatically when the pause period ends. If you do not want to be charged ever again, always choose "Cancel subscription", not "Pause".

Mistake 4: cancelling on the last day of your billing cycle

If you cancel on day 29 of a 30-day billing period, you will still be charged on day 30 because the charge processes before your cancellation is confirmed. Stopee recommends cancelling at least 3 days before your renewal date to ensure the cancellation goes through before the system processes the next charge.

Mistake 5: not keeping proof of cancellation

If you cancel without taking a screenshot or saving the confirmation email, you have no evidence that you cancelled if a dispute arises. Banks and e-wallet providers will ask for proof before refunding you. Save everything.

What happens after you cancel Freeletics

The moment you see that cancellation confirmation, it is natural to feel relieved-but there are a few important things to know about what comes next.

Your access during the current billing period

Cancelling Freeletics does not immediately cut off your access. You can still use the app and website until your current billing period ends. For example, if you subscribed to a 12-week plan on 1 January, your renewal is scheduled for around 22 March. If you cancel on 1 March, you still have full access until 22 March. On 23 March, your access disappears and you cannot log in anymore.

This is actually good news-you have time to download your training history and save any progress photos before access is removed.

Watching your next statement

On the date your billing period would have renewed, check your bank account, credit card, or e-wallet. If you see a charge from Freeletics, this is unexpected and you should contact support and your bank immediately. If no charge appears, your cancellation worked correctly.

Stopee recommends setting a calendar reminder for this date so you do not forget to check. Many people cancel and then forget about it entirely, only to discover months later that they were charged again.

If you change your mind and want to resubscribe

Cancelling Freeletics does not delete your account. You can log back in anytime and resubscribe to any plan at full price. Previous subscribers do not receive loyalty discounts in most cases, so treat it as a fresh signup if you return.
